Timezone in Fort Novosel
Fort Novosel is situated in the America/Chicago timezone, which has a UTC offset of -6 hours during standard time. When daylight saving time is in effect, typically from the second Sunday in March to the first Sunday in November, the offset changes to -5 hours. This means that clocks are set forward one hour in the spring and set back one hour in the fall.
In relation to the broader United States, Fort Novosel aligns with many areas in the Central Time Zone, allowing for similar business hours and communication patterns across states like Illinois and Texas. Practical Information for Visitors
Fort Novosel is located in Alabama, near the town of Ozark. The nearest airport is Dothan Regional Airport, about 25 miles away, which offers regional flights. If you’re traveling by train, the closest Amtrak station is in Birmingham, roughly 100 miles away.
Local bus services may be limited, so renting a car is advisable for convenience. The climate in Fort Novosel generally features hot summers and mild winters. Summers can be quite humid, with temperatures often exceeding 90 degrees Fahrenheit, while winters typically see highs in the 50s and lows near freezing.
The best time to visit is during the spring and fall when temperatures are moderate, making outdoor activities more enjoyable.
